2023 CoC Program Competition

The Process for Applying

On behalf of the Cleveland/Cuyahoga County Continuum of Care, the Cuyahoga County Office of Homeless Services (OHS) the collaborative applicant, invites eligible organizations to submit new or renewal applications for CoC funding to be included in the 2023 Collaborative Application to HUD. The only entities that may submit a renewal application are current HUD CoC grantees that have a grant with an end date in calendar year 2024.

2023 CoC NOFO Request for Applications, New Project submissions due June 30, 2023

The 2023 Local competition for HUD CoC Funding has opened. Renewal project applications must be submitted in E-snaps by August 18, 2023, new project applications must be submitted by August 25, 2023 by 5 pm Eastern time.
